Scott is correct,
we made maneuvers equal in points at the request of multiple players.

Regarding the armies--the culture of the club is one we create. I still mostly play "French" players. We have run army vs army tournaments in the past, corps vs corps, etc, and I plan on doing some for Republican Bayonets on the Rhine when I get a chance.


One thing that helps create a culture where each army has an identity is more members helping make direct connections to each other and not just on the boards--- this means training new players, helping players find opponents at their skill level and with similar play styles, tournaments and challenges, and things like that.

So, if anyone wants to help create more connections within the club, send me a message through the boards or post here. I have a lot more ideas than I have time!
